The Centre shall assume the defence of any director of the Centre prosecuted by a third person for an act done in the performance of his duties and shall pay the damages, if any, resulting from that act, unless the director has committed a grievous offence or a personal offence separable from the performance of his duties.
Notwithstanding the foregoing, in a penal or criminal proceeding, the Centre shall assume the payment of the expenses of a director of the Centre only if he had reasonable grounds to believe that his conduct was in conformity with the law or if he has been discharged or acquitted.
